Taxonomic and Palynological Diversity of the Family Papilionaceae in the Flora of Shishi Koh Valley, Chitral, Pakistan.

Abstract:
The research project was conducted to study the diversity of family Papilionaceae in the flora of Shishi Koh Valley, Chitral. Plants were described on the basis of taxonomy and playnology. Family Papilionaceae was represented by thirty eight plants including thirty one species, three subspecies and four varieties. These plants belonged to ten tribes and fifteen genera. Among them Trifolieae was the dominant tribe with four genera i.e. Medicago, Trifolium, Melilotus and Trigonella. The dominant genus Medicago contributed five species and three varieties. Trifolium, Trigonella and Melilotus were represented by six, four and three species respectively. The next dominant tribes were Vicieae and Phaseoleae with seven and three species respectively. The remaining tribes were each represented by a single genus and species. Each tribe's contribution in the form of genera, species and infra-specific categories has been assessed. Palynological study of ten species with wide distribution showed a considerable degree of pollen variation. Monad pollen mostly of ellipsoid and oblong shapes were the characteristics of all the specimens discussed so for. Pollen apertures were mostly zono and colpate. Common size class was mediae, exine sculpture was reticulate and symmetry was bilateral.
